You are human and your mind will wonder to thoughts that are not helpful. It happens to all of us.

 

Second guessing, the what if's, maybe I was expecting to much? and on and on. Let all that go, you are doing the right thing for you and your life.

 

Staying busy is key in times like this. There will always be times when your mind wonders but there is a trick I used that worked pretty well for me. When I found myself thinking about stuff I couldn't change or thoughts that were not helpful I would ask myself "What good is coming from this?" the answer was always nothing so it would help me stop the cycle and move onto other thoughts. To distract myself I would try and remember all the words to some of my old favorite songs and sing it in my head. Silly but it worked.

 

Friends and family need to be your support system right now. Don't pester them with constant phone calls every time you feel down but do engage with them. I would bet good money during this relationship you spoke to and saw your friends and family far less than you should have so reverse that situation. I am sure they would love to see or hear from you. Perhaps you could offer to babysit or suggest dinner with a few friends.

 

The heart and mind can be stubborn and many times we start thinking our lives will never be good because we haven't found the ONE yet. Make your life great for you, make plans with the people in your life and live that life to show your heart and mind that yes my life is good and getting better each day.

 

The unknown is always the thing that haunts us so take charge of as much of your life as possible and many of your doubts will fade. Once you are in a good place in your life love will find you...
